Hey guys, Im just wondering how you can tell when/if a dvd burner is bad. I Currently use an LG GH22LP20 burner and as of last night it will not burn faster then 1.6x anymore. Nothing unusual happened, I do think ive burned well over 2k discs on it. Any advice/suggestions? Thanks
BTW I use the latest version of IMGBurn.

It's probably not bad, just running in PIO mode. Delete your primary or secondary IDE controller (whichever the drive is on) or both of them (to be sure) from your device tree and reboot.

@GKar- Thanks a lot bro it worked. I removed the drive and updated to latest firmware and everything is running smooth as silk. I have to be honest with you, this is one of the better drives I've ever owned. Cheers!

I have two of them myself. If you want to get a little more out of them on the ripping side you can try Mediacodespeededit to patch it and get up to 16x read speed out of it, worked for me (depending on the media of course).
